According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, prices for photographic equipment and supplies are 5.64% lower in 2026 versus 1978 (a $1.13 difference in value).
Between 1978 and 2026:Photographic equipment and supplies experienced an average inflation rate of -0.12% per year. In other words, photographic equipment and supplies costing $20 in the year 1978 would cost $18.87 in 2026 for an equivalent purchase. Compared to the overall inflation rate of 3.40% during this same period, inflation for photographic equipment and supplies was significantly lower.
In the year 1978: Pricing changed by 3.23%, which is significantly above the average yearly change for photographic equipment and supplies during the 1978-2026 time period. Compared to inflation for all items in 1978 (7.63%), inflation for photographic equipment and supplies was much lower.
